I always say we have three jobs no matter what your position is and what kind of business you are in… the “Sales”, “Marketing”, and “Customer Support” business. When we are working with clients or potential clients, we have to communicate features and benefits. These positions and details can come in two forms… Opinions and Story.
They are defined like this:
- Opinion – “a view or judgment formed about something, not necessarily based on fact or knowledge”
- Story – ” an account of past events in someone's life or in the evolution of something”
In this episode, we will discuss both and how they can affect your being perceived as a Thought Leader. Both have a place in business and both have certain powers of persuasion that can make a big difference in the areas of “Sales”, “Marketing”, and “Customer Support”.
